23 // ClientUserInterface is an interface that must be implemented by
24 // applications embedding the Chromoting client, to provide client's user
25 // interface.
26 //
27 // TODO(sergeyu): Cleanup this interface, see crbug.com/138108 .
28 class ClientUserInterface {
29  public:
~ClientUserInterface()30   virtual ~ClientUserInterface() {}
31 
32   // Record the update the state of the connection, updating the UI as needed.
33   virtual void OnConnectionState(protocol::ConnectionToHost::State state,
34                                  protocol::ErrorCode error) = 0;
35   virtual void OnConnectionReady(bool ready) = 0;
36   virtual void OnRouteChanged(const std::string& channel_name,
37                               const protocol::TransportRoute& route) = 0;
38 
39   // Passes the final set of capabilities negotiated between the client and host
40   // to the application.
41   virtual void SetCapabilities(const std::string& capabilities) = 0;
42 
43   // Passes a pairing response message to the client.
44   virtual void SetPairingResponse(
45       const protocol::PairingResponse& pairing_response) = 0;
46 
47   // Deliver an extension message from the host to the client.
48   virtual void DeliverHostMessage(
49       const protocol::ExtensionMessage& message) = 0;
50 
51   // Get the view's ClipboardStub implementation.
52   virtual protocol::ClipboardStub* GetClipboardStub() = 0;
53 
54   // Get the view's CursorShapeStub implementation.
55   virtual protocol::CursorShapeStub* GetCursorShapeStub() = 0;
56 
57   // Get the view's TokenFetcher implementation.
58   // The TokenFetcher implementation may require interactive authentication.
59   virtual scoped_ptr<protocol::ThirdPartyClientAuthenticator::TokenFetcher>
60   GetTokenFetcher(const std::string& host_public_key) = 0;
61 };
